
IPOD Notebook is your key to success! One of the most important things in fourth/fifth grades is to learn how to organize your papers and assignments.
Inside this notebook you will keep your classmates’addresses, homework assignments, handouts for the upcoming tests, and much, much more! Please keep the sections of your IPOD neat and organized. Clean it every weekend.
In order to make your IPOD Notebook, you will need a few things:
- 1 inch binder with a clear cover
- dividers
- IPOD skin (the cover for your binder, will be provided by the teacher, you can color it)
- Planner pages (provided by the teacher)
- binder whole puncher (optional, but strongly recommended)
Below is the description of the IPOD sections (click on the description to see a printable version):

1. Calendar Section is not really a section, but a place in front of all the dividers in your binder. This is where we will put in the calendar or any other papers that might be important for your work. |

2. Planner Section is reserved for writing down homework every day. The homework is posted on the web site, but students MUST write it down when directed in class. Internet may not always be avialable, so it is much better to write down your assignments in the Planner Section. These sections need to be signed by your parents every day! |

3. Test Prep Section is reserved for any kind of handouts that will help students to prepare for the tests. For example, it can include vocabulary and spelling lists, multiplication minute math drills, and any other paper that may be helpful in preparation for the tests. |

4. Reading Section is for Reading Logs, Book Reports, and other reading assignments. |

5. Projects Section is reserved for the descriptions of big projects, such as Science Fair, Glogster posters. It may include planning for multimedia (computer) projects, research reports in Science and Social Studies. |

6. Homework Section does not need to have a divider. You will be able to see it easily without a divider because it will have two folders. One is for the homework, due and done, and the other folder will include letters from school, the ones for information only and the special ones that needs to be signed by your parents. |

7. Art Section will have art projects, lyrics to the songs we sing in class, possibly scripts or other performances. |

8. Class Section is one of students’ favorite sections because it has everything about our class life. It will have a list of class jobs, information about class web site, our class phone book, and much more. |
